Thumbs up New vendor on the market!

Hi guys.

There's a new vendor on the market, and this news will probably be of interest to those looking to buy a new telescope or accessories.

The shop is called My Astro Shop, and is being launched by Steve Massey, the well known amateur astronomer, astrophotographer and author.

He's selling SkyWatcher gear, made in the Synta factory in China. It's an alternative to the GSO brand offered by Bintel and Andrews.

Steve says that he tests everything before he lists it on the site, so you can be sure he won't sell stuff he hasn't used and recommends himself.

IceInSpace has no affiliation with MyAstroShop, but when a new vendor comes onto the (small) Australian market it's pretty big news so I felt it deserved a thread.

However because Steve is a member of the IceInSpace Forums (videoguy) and likes the IceInSpace Community and what we do here, he's said that IceInSpace members can receive discounts off the listed price of items simply by giving him a call or a PM.

I think it's great that there's some more competition in the Australian market, and when we recommend dobs to newbies, we can offer a choice of more than just two suppliers now.
